Operadores en MySQL

Hola de nuevo. Esperamos que estén muy bien y con toda la disposición del mundo para continuar con nuestro aprendizaje de MySQL.

En MySQL además de llevar a cabo las operaciones con bases de datos, podemos también llevar a cabo operaciones, no sólo con datos guardados en la base de datos, sino también con valores que no necesariamente formen parte de nuestra base de datos.

Todos conocemos las operaciones básicas, es decir: la suma, la multiplicación, la resta y la división. Todas estas operaciones pueden llevarse a cabo sin problemas en MySQL sin necesidad de recurrir a datos que estén guardados en la base de datos.

La forma en la que vamos a hacer dichas operaciones es a través de la sentencia SELECT (otras de las bondades de esta sentencia), de la siguiente forma:

SELECT operación;

Así, la sentencia

SELECT 2+2;

Nos daría como resultado 4 (a que no esperaban una respuesta de este tipo). Con todo, debemos tener cuidado de la precedencia de los operadores, ya que algunos operadores tiene mayor precedencia que otros y, por ejemplo, si hacemos la siguiente operación:

SELECT 5 + 2 * 2;

La respuesta no será 14 (teniendo que cuenta que las operaciones se realizan de izquierda a derecha), sino que será 9, ya que la multiplicación tiene prioridad sobre la suma (lo cual podría tomarse como una especie de racismo matemático, pero por fortuna eso, en las sabias e inteligentes matemáticas, no existe).

Finalmente, y antes de ver a los operadores en acción, mencionemos un operador nuevo (al menos en cuanto a las operaciones matemáticas se refiere), este es, el operador Módulo (%). Para aquellos conocedores de C, C++ o PHP les será muy conocido nuestro viejo amigo Módulo. Este operador proporciona el residuo de un cociente, por ejemplo, la operación:

SELECT 6 % 4;

Nos da como resultado 2, siendo que el residuo de la división entre 6 y 4 es 2. Si lo que se están preguntando es la utilidad de este operador, en realidad depende de las necesidades de cada aplicación o de cada operación que necesitemos efectuar con nuestra base de datos.

Ahora sí queridos amigos, veamos el resultado de hacer operaciones con MySQL:

 

[Objeto Flash Eliminado]

 

En nuestra siguiente lección vamos a ver operaciones lógicas en MySQL, por el momento, quédense con las palabras del maestro Joaquín Sabina: “El gobierno si yo fuera presidente, no dudaría tanto en hincarle el diente, al ruido de sables que hay cada mes, que se cruzan los cables del coronel” ¿Qué tal? ¡Sabina para presidente!, ¿no les parece? Hasta Pronto.

Contenidos que te pueden interesar
Este sitio usa cookies para personalizar el contenido y los anuncios, ofrecer funciones de redes sociales y analizar el tráfico. Ninguna cookie será instalada a menos que se desplace exprésamente más de 400px. Leer nuestra Política de Privacidad y Política de Cookies. Las acepto | No quiero aprender cursos gratis. Sácame